One of Durham's oldest houses of worship houses this center for African-American art and culture. In addition to exhibitions of traditional and contemporary art by local, regional, and national artists, the center hosts events like the Bull Durham Blues Festival and the Black Diaspora Film Festival.

In ShortWhat used to be the spiritual and economic hub of black Durham, the Hayti neighborhood, had all but faded away. Until the Hayti Heritage Center opened almost a decade ago--community center, public space and art gallery. They do a little of everything: poetry readings, summer camps, concerts and lectures. Their mission: to showcase the art of the community and serve as a cultural outlet....
